Another great idea from Martha. They used two different colored sheets of tissue paper and wrapped around a glass cylinder vase. I have so many vases left over from the wedding and just inherited a ton of tissue paper. I think these would be great on our front steps to welcome in trick-or-treaters.

Marie over at Watch the Wind Blow By came up with this great idea. She made a knock off of a Ballard Design product. She used alphabet stamps on small pieces of wood, but you could also easily print out letters or designs and decoupage them onto wood pieces. So easy and inexpensive!

A great idea from Martha….Hollow out a pumpkin and punch holes out with an apple corer. Rub cinnamon or pumpkin spices on lid and put cloves inside. Drop in a tealight and you’ll have incense that smells just like fresh pumpkin pie!
